” I have actually carried out some research into Skype counselling,” states London-based psychotherapist Dr Aaron Balick, “and it’s not the ‘practical equivalent’ of standard counselling; it’s simply not quite the exact same thing. It’s actually important that people who engage in it understand that it’s a various experience from being in the space with somebody, speaking in person.”

In cases of mild depression, the NHS is now directing some patients towards online programmes instead of face-to-face counselling, a phenomenon that worries Dr Balick. Online Counselling Link Of Jeec Up
” My worry is that it’s occurring increasingly more for economic reasons, rather than since it’s what’s finest for people. If it’s rolled out simply to conserve cash and there aren’t crucial questions being asked about these services, that’s not good. But then, I’m constantly extremely sceptical of people who are either extremely very pro or really very versus online mental healthcare. It’s a case of asking the right questions.”

How does it work?
As seen on FB (by me, anyway), US business is the corporate behemoth of the e-counselling game. They declare to have 500 licensed counsellors working for them, each with at least 3 years of experience.
After filling out a questionnaire to ascertain what specific flavour of psychological you are, you’re paired with a counsellor, who you can mercilessly switch for a different one at any time. (I got Dr. Laura Dabney, from Virginia). You then kick off an instant messaged treatment session that both you and your counsellor can drop in and out of, and which could, in theory, go on and on up until among you eventually died.
What does it cost?
You get a free seven-day trial – similar to a complimentary Netflix or Amazon Prime trial, except with way more questions about what your youth was like. After that, it costs from , 24.50 a week for endless message-based counselling and one ‘totally free’ phone session with your counsellor per month.
